Just one year removed from seeing mega-prospect Bryce Harper depart for higher levels, the Hagerstown Suns’ roster posses more talent now than ever before. They currently have a record of 42-27 and although I know wins don’t mean anything in the minors it does help illustrate how good this team is compared to the other South Atlantic League ball clubs. There are obviously a number of guys contributing to their dominance, but here are some of the biggest standouts:
Billy Burns, OF, age 22
.314 AVG, 0 HR, 25 RBI, 24 SB, .424 OBP, .390 SLG, .814 OPS
